Allman Brothers Band 06/26/71
Fillmore East (2 shows), New York, NY
Set I
Statesboro Blues, Trouble No More, Don't Keep Me Wonderin', Done Somebody Wrong, One Way Out, In Memory of Elizabeth Reed, Midnight Rider, Hot 'Lanta, Stormy Monday, Revival, Don't Want You No More -> It's Not My Cross To Bear, Dreams I'll Never See, You Don't Love Me, Whipping Post, Mountain Jam,two hour jam!, partial and out of order

Comment
A witness states these shows were not recorded and are therefore not in circulation. If you have ABB material from the Fillmore closing it would be from the next night, 6/27/71.
